NSP modules, proven by many international certifications, are defined by their high performance and excellent quality. With high efficiency solar cells, state-of-art manufacturing technology, and long-term reliability, NSP modules are ideal choices for their high efficiency and cost-effectiveness.
NSP/DelSolar Modules, proven by many international certifications, are defined by its high performance and excellent quality. NSP/DelSolar modules are certified by TüV Rheinland, UL and MCS. The modules provide positive and tight power tolerances of 0 to +4.99Wp, which offer a stable and high-energy system output. With high efficiency solar cells, state-of-art manufacturing technology, and long-term reliability, NSP/DelSolar modules are ideal choices for their high efficiency and cost-effectiveness. High Performance
Power tolerance of 0 to +4.99Wp, providing a stable, high-energy system output
High PV cell shunt resistance enabling increased power output in low light conditions
Low temperature coefficients of power to produce high power output in all weather conditions
High efficiency solar cells and state-of-art manufacturing technology to enhance cost efficacy per kWh
High wind/snow load tolerant
Ammonia-reisitant according to IEC62716
